Maria Frias is a Brazilian media executive who inherited a stake in Folha de S.Paulo, one of Brazil's most popular newspapers. With a background in journalism, she has navigated the media landscape and is now focused on her role in the family's media business. Her career reflects the evolving media industry in Brazil. The Full Dossier

Early Life

Information on Maria Frias's early life is limited, but she is known to be the heir to a portion of the Folha de S.Paulo media empire. She is the daughter of Octávio Frias, who acquired the precursor to the newspaper in the 1960s. Her brother, Luiz Frias, runs the conglomerate. Maria inherited a third of the media giant after her father's passing in 2007.

Rise to Success

Maria Frias entered the media landscape as a journalist and later became involved in the management of Folha de S.Paulo. With her brother Luiz at the helm, she contributes to the strategic direction of the media group. The media group includes newspapers, television, radio, internet pages, and magazines. She has contributed to transforming the Folha de S.Paulo into a modern media company, expanding its reach both in Brazil and internationally.
